By default every queue gets the **noop** merger (always succeeds — for local dev and compose). Point `MERGE_CONFIG_PATH` at a merge configuration file to wire real **git** merge targets, or set `MERGE_CHECKOUT_PATH` to configure a single one from the environment (see Configuration). Setting `MERGER=git` makes Git configuration mandatory: startup fails unless one of those sources defines at least one Git target. Two queues naming the same checkout resolve to the *same* merger instance, which is what serializes them against each other: a git merger locks the working tree it owns, and two instances over one tree would reset it out from under each other mid-merge. Naming one checkout for two *different* targets is rejected at startup. @@ -71,6 +71,7 @@ The Runway controllers themselves live under [`runway/controller/`](../../runway | `QUEUE_MYSQL_DSN` | yes | Queue database DSN | — | | `PORT` | no | gRPC listen address | `:8086` | | `HOSTNAME` | no | Subscriber name for the queue consumer | `runway-` | +| `MERGER` | no | Explicit merger selection. `git` requires `MERGE_CHECKOUT_PATH` or a `MERGE_CONFIG_PATH` file containing at least one Git target; `noop` forces synthetic success; `fake` is test-only.
